Keeping the battery small makes the bike light enough to be able to pedal without power not too bad like a heavy bike but with 30mph on demand. Light pedaling and light throttle at moderate speeds can easily take you 4x the distance of just going full throttle.

It takes getting used to at first but i love extra "slack" feeling you get during turns from raising the forks suspension. Really adds to stability at speeds and makes turning a lot less sensitive. I've seen builds of people running 180mm+ dual crowns on this frame with no problem so i see no issue with 150mm.

Still have to get new tires, need a real battery, and thinking of going 72v but i really only want to go a little faster than I already do at best... this hub goes crazy fast on its stock 22/26a controller im thinking with a 48v 1500w controller @ 130% over speed it would be more than enough speed, but higher voltage is more efficient.
